David Yang, an astronaut standing 1.76 meters tall with thick eyebrows, big eyes, a straight nose, and slightly upturned lips, looked like an attractive Asian guy. In reality, he was of mixed Chinese-American descent. He was running on a treadmill, and the words of Jamie, the head of the International Space Center, echoed in his ears: “You are the leader of this space mission. During the mission, when you encounter any difficulties, you must be brave, calm, and rational. Humanity has never ventured so far to explore extraterrestrial life. I hope you will successfully complete the mission and return safely. I wish you the best of luck!”

The time for departure had arrived. David Yang and the other two astronauts, John and Philip, each said their goodbyes to their families. David's eyes remained dry as he reassured his parents and brother, saying, "Think of it as a business trip; you can watch my hologram whenever you miss me." Philip, who stood 1.78 meters tall with short, ear-length hair, and a sweet appearance, couldn’t stop his tears and clung to his mother. His father patted his shoulder and said, "Be brave. You are the pride of this planet and will return successfully." John, who was 1.73 meters tall with a bushy beard that made him look older, kissed his parents and simply said, "Pray for me. Goodbye!" He then turned and walked toward the spaceship, with the others following him.

The spaceship, the SP, had two levels: the upper level was for living, and the lower level housed the equipment. The astronauts mainly stayed on the living level. The equipment level contained a small emergency rescue ship, which the astronauts could use to escape in case of an accident, abandoning the main spaceship. There was also an amphibious craft stored there.

After entering the spaceship and sealing the doors, each astronaut took their seat and strapped in. David Yang sat in the middle, John on the left, and Philip on the right. A screen above the control panel displayed: "Ready for Departure!"

David shouted, "Are you all ready?" John and Philip responded in unison, "Ready!" With a press of a button from David, the spaceship roared to life and shot into the sky, heading straight for the planet Gliese 581c on its predetermined trajectory.
